AI, LLMs, and the promise of Agentic AI are currently on everyones lips. However, if you are creating data for the purpose of managing a company, neural networks based technologies have deficiencies. For a sustainable management, you need stable data products and neural networks based solutions were never designed to serve that purpose. Its not an one/other game, its about processes designed to leverage each technology's unique advantages. There is a difference between leveraging data and creating new fundamental data products. This difference needs to be understood for the enablement of Agentic infrastructure.
